Knežev Dvor - Duke's Palace is in the main square opposite the church of St. Mary. Built in the 15th century, and served as the residence of government of the island during of the reign of the Venetian rule. It was the residence of the Duke appointed by the supremacy of Venice.
Knežev Dvor is decorated with beautiful fountain with embellished shaft and two old, tall palm trees, that together with the stone setting and richly decorated arch at the palace door, leaves the impression of old-Dalmatian ambiance.
Knežev Dvor is today renovated monument, used to perform a variety of shows, choir performances, for Pag cultural summer etc, during the summer months.
